The Kansas Soil Health Alliance, along with No-Till on the Plains, Kansas Grazing Lands Coalition and American Farmland Trust, has planned a grazing tour August 11-12 in southwest Kansas. The two-day bus tour will visit Lohrding 3 Bar Ranch, Lazy KT Ranch and Wiltse Family Farms.
Featured speakers will include Kurt Dale, who will give a presentation on custom grazing, and Robert Ellis, who will discuss economic case studies of grazing in Kansas. Other topics to be covered will include managed grazing, wildlife management and woody encroachment.
